Output 34aa9b26963833ac961215a497c26fef44ec95156530a69e8c9fbea1bff8ca80:1

value
21800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468972233b71536df05897d6a047434deb951334 OP_EQUAL
address
MEL8BmELqMJQmUzTZxdGcFfEBTRyWtHcQv
transaction
34aa9b26963833ac961215a497c26fef44ec95156530a69e8c9fbea1bff8ca80
spent
true